The 2022 update to the Sixth Edition of Corporate Finance and the Securities Laws was recently published by Wolters Kluwer.

The update includes discussions of the recent regulatory approach to digital currencies, the accounting and disclosure consequences of the Russian invasion of the Ukraine and subsequent sanctions, the unexpected SEC staff position regarding Rule 15c2-11, structured notes related regulatory developments, and convertible securities market developments.  The update also addresses potential changes to the investor counting rules, “greenwashing” concerns and other developments relating to ESG related debt securities, REIT market developments given the increased interest in non-traded REITs, and more.
